html
{
    min-height: 100%;
}

body
{
	margin: 0;
	padding: 0;
	font-family:  Arial, Helvetica, Geneva, Swiss, SunSans-Regular;
	font-size: 11px;
	color: black;
    height: 100%;
	background: #080008 url('../images/backgroundRepeat.gif') repeat-y center;
}

img
{
	border: 0;
}

p{
    margin-top: 0;
}
/*link*/
a, a:hover
{
	color: blue;
	text-decoration: underline;
    outline: none;
}

#footer a
{
	color: white;
	text-decoration: none;	
}

#footer a:hover, #footer a.active
{
	background-color: #002559;	
}

#submenu li a, #nieuwsList li a, #mediaMenu li a
{
	color: white;
	font-weight: bold;
	text-decoration: none;
    display: block;
}

#submenu li a:hover, #submenu li a.active, #nieuwsList li a:hover, #nieuwsList li a.active, #mediaMenu li a:hover, #mediaMenu li a.active
{
	background-color: #002559;
}
/*end link*/

/*containers*/
#mainContainer
{
	width: 800px;
	padding: 0;
	margin: auto;
}

#container
{
	float: left;
	width: 800px;
	padding: 0;
	margin: 0;

}
/*end containers*/

/*header*/
#header
{
	float: left;
	width: 298px;
	height: 86px;
	padding: 7px 475px 37px 27px;
	margin: 0;
    background: url('../images/header_v1.jpg');
}
/*end header*/

/*menu*/
#menu
{
	float: left;
	width: 800px;
	height: 28px;
	padding: 0;
	margin: 0;	
    text-align: center;
}

#menu ul
{
    float: left;
	width: 800px;
    height: 28px;
	padding: 0;
	margin: 0;	
	list-style-type: none;
	background: url('../images/blokje_kleur.gif') repeat-x;
}

#menu ul li
{
    display: inline-block;
	height: 28px;
	padding: 0 11px 0 11px;
	margin: 0;
	background: url('../images/borderMenu.gif') right no-repeat;
}
/*end menu*/

/*content*/
#contentContainer
{
	float: left;
	width: 800px;
	padding: 0;
	margin: 0;		
}

#content
{
    float: left;
    width: 578px;
    padding: 20px 120px 20px 17px;
    margin: 0 85px;
    overflow: auto;
	letter-spacing: 0.8pt;
	line-height: 20px;
    overflow-x: hidden;
    background: url('../images/backgroundOverOnsRep.png') left repeat-y;
}

#contentLeft
{
	float: left;
	width: 173px;
	padding: 0;
	margin: 0;
}

#location
{
	float: left;
	width: 148px;
	height: 55px;
	padding: 12px 0px 12px 5px;
	margin: 0;
	list-style-type: none;
}

#location ul
{
    padding: 0;
    margin: 0;
    float: left;
}

#location li
{
	float: left;
	width: 143px;
	height: 55px;
	padding: 0;
	margin: 0 0 4px 0;
	list-style-type: none;
}

.locationPicture
{
	float: left;
	width: 55px;
	height: 55px;
	padding: 0;
	margin: 0 4px 0 0;
}

.locationText
{
	float: left;
	width: 80px;
	height: 50px;
	padding: 5px 0 0 0;
	margin: 0;
	font-size: 9px;
}

#submenu, #nieuwsList, #mediaMenu
{
	float: left;
	width: 160px;
	height: 55px;
	padding: 11px 5px 12px 8px;
	margin: 0;
	list-style-type: none;	
}

#submenu li, #mediaMenu li
{
	float: left;
	width: 160px;
	padding: 0;
	margin: 0;
	line-height: 20px;
	list-style-type: none;
	letter-spacing: 0.8pt;
}

#nieuwslist li
{
	float: left;
	width: 153px;
	padding: 0;
	margin: 0;
	line-height: 16px;
	list-style-type: none;
	letter-spacing: 0.8pt;
}

#contentRight
{
	float: left;
	width: 587px;
	padding: 11px 20px 15px 20px;
    height: 600px;
    overflow: auto;
	margin: 0;
	letter-spacing: 0.8pt;
	line-height: 20px;
    overflow-x: hidden;
}

#contentRight ul
{
	padding: 0;
	margin: 0 0 0 15px;
}

#locationList
{
	float: left;
	width: 587px;
	padding: 0;
	margin: 0 0 0 5px;
	list-style-type: none;
}

#locationList li
{
	float: left;
	width: 587px;
	padding: 0;
	margin: 0 0 45px 0;
}

.gerechtLeft{
    float: left;
    width: 305px;
    padding: 0;
    margin: 0;
}

.gerechtRight{
    float: left;
    width: 248px;
    min-height: 50px;
    padding: 0;
    margin: 0 0 0 10px;
}

.gerechtRight ul{
    float: left;
    width: 248px;
    padding: 0;
    margin:0;
    list-style-type: none;
}

.gerechtRight ul li{
    float: left;
    width: 248px;
    padding: 0;
    margin:0 0 10px 0;
}

#contact
{
	float: left;
    padding: 0;
	margin: 0;
	vertical-align: top;
	color: white;
}

#contact td
{
	vertical-align: top;
}

#contactForm
{
	padding: 0;
	margin: 0;
	vertical-align: top;
}

#mainListContact{
    float: left;
   	width: 587px;
    padding: 0;
    margin: 0;
    list-style-type: none;
}

#mainListContact li{
    float: left;
   	width: 587px;
    padding: 0;
    margin: 0;
}

.mainBox{
    float: left;
   	width: 587px;
    padding: 0;
    margin: 0;
}

.mainTitleBox {
    float: left;
   	width: 587px;
    height: 20px;
    padding: 0 0 0 25px;
    margin: 0;
	font-size: 15px;
	font-weight: bold;
	color: #002059;
	margin-bottom: 10px;
    text-decoration: none;
}

.mainTitleBox.expanded {
    background: url('../images/arrowBlueDown.png') no-repeat left;
}

.mainTitleBox.collapsed {
    background: url('../images/arrowBlueRight.png') no-repeat left;
}

.mainTitleBox:hover {
    text-decoration: none;
    color: #002059;
}

.subTitleBox {
    float: left;
    height: 20px;
    padding: 0 0 0 25px;
    margin: 0;
	font-size: 15px;
	font-weight: bold;
	color: #ffffff;
	margin-bottom: 10px;
    text-decoration: none;
   	width: 500px;
}

.subTitleBox.expanded {
    background: url('../images/arrowWhiteDown.png') no-repeat left;
}

.subTitleBox.collapsed {
    background: url('../images/arrowWhiteRight.png') no-repeat left;
}

.subTitleBox:hover {
    text-decoration: none;
    color: #ffffff;
}

.listContent {
    float: left;
    display: none;
    width: 587px;
    margin: 0;
    padding: 0;
}

.mainTextBoxLeft{
    float: left;
    width: 325px;
    padding: 0;
    margin: 0 0 0 25px;
}

.mainTextBoxRight{
    float: left;
    width: 200px;
    padding: 0;
    margin: 0;
}

#subListContact{
    float: left;
   	width: 525px;
    padding: 0;
    margin: 0;
    list-style-type: none;
}

#subListContact li{
    float: left;
   	width: 525px;
    padding: 0;
    margin: 0 0 20px 0;
}

.subBox{
    float: left;
   	width: 500px;
    padding: 0 0 0 10px;
    margin: 0;
}

.subTitleBoxArrow{
    float: left;
   	width: 12px;
    padding: 3px 1px 0 0;
    margin: 0 12px 0 0;
}

.subTitleBoxTitle{
    float: left;
    padding: 0;
    margin: 0;
}

.subTextBox{
    float: left;
    width: 500px;
    padding: 0;
    margin: 0 0 0 25px;
    display: none;
}

#maps {
    float: left;
    width: 200px;
    height: 180px;
    padding: 0;
    background: #2d383f;
}

.field200
{
	border: 1px solid #002559;
	width: 202px;
}

.field202
{
	border: 1px solid #002559;
	width: 202px;
	height: 145px;
}

.sendButton
{
	float: right;
    background: url('../images/senButton.gif');
	width: 65px;
	height: 17px;
	border: 0;
	cursor: pointer;
	padding: 0;
	margin: 0;
}

#mediaList{
    float: left;
    width: 500px;
    padding: 0;
    margin: 0;
    list-style-type: none;
}

#mediaList li{
    float: left;
    width: 500px;
    padding: 0;
    margin: 0 0 20px 0;
}

.mediaTitle{
    float: left;
    width: 500px;
    margin: 0 0 10px 0;
}

.mediaTitle a{
    font-size: 15px;
	font-weight: bold;
	color: #002059;
    text-decoration: none;
}

.mediaMovie{
    float: left;
    width: 500px;
    height: 350px;
}
/*end content*/

/*footer*/
#footer
{
	float: left;
	width: 800px;
	padding: 0;
	margin: 0;
	color: white;
	font-weight: bold;
	text-align: center;
}

#footerTop
{
	float: left;
	width: 800px;
	height: 18px;
	padding: 0;
	margin: 0;
	list-style-type: none;
	text-align: center;
}

#footerTop li, #footerBottom li
{
	height: 18px;
	padding: 0 11px 0 0;
	margin: 0;
	text-align: center;
	background: url('../images/bullitFooter.gif') no-repeat right;
	display: inline;
	letter-spacing: 1px;
}

#footerBottom 
{
	float: left;
	width: 800px;
	height: 18px;
	padding: 0;
	margin: 2px 0 0 0;
	list-style-type: none;
	text-align: center;
}
/*end footeru*/

/*titles*/
h1, h2, h3, h4{
	padding: 0;
	margin: 0;
	font-weight: bold;
	font-family:  Arial, sans-serif;
}

h1
{
	font-size: 15px;
	color: #002059;
	font-weight: bold;
}

h2
{
	font-size: 11px;
	color: #A59875;
	font-weight: bold;
}

h3
{
	font-size: 13px;
	color: #002059;
 	font-weight: bold;
}

h4
{
	font-size: 15px;
	color: #002059;
	font-weight: bold;
}
/*end titles*/

#image1
{
    margin-right:16px;
    float:left;
}

#image2
{
    float:left;
}
